The Ultimate Buying Guide: Choosing the Best Treats for Your Cat with Kidney Issues

When your beloved feline is diagnosed with kidney disease, their diet becomes very important. Treats, once a simple joy, now require careful thought. You want to reward your cat without hurting their kidneys. This guide helps you find the perfect, safe treats.

Key Features to Look For in Kidney-Friendly Treats

The best treats for cats with kidney disease focus on what the kidneys struggle to process. Look for these main features:

  • Low Phosphorus: This is the most crucial factor. Damaged kidneys struggle to remove phosphorus. High levels can make the disease worse. Always check the guaranteed analysis for low numbers.
  • Moderate to High Quality Protein: Cats need protein, but too much can stress the kidneys. Look for highly digestible, high-quality protein sources. Avoid mystery meat meals.
  • Low Sodium (Salt): High salt levels can increase thirst and blood pressure, both bad for sick kidneys. Choose treats with minimal added salt.
  • High Moisture Content (If Possible): Hydration is key for kidney cats. Treats that are slightly moist or freeze-dried and rehydrated can help support water intake.
Important Ingredients: What to Seek and What to Skip

Ingredients tell the whole story about a treat’s safety. Understanding what goes into the bag guides your purchase.

Ingredients to Seek Out:
  • Specific, Named Meats: Chicken breast, tuna (in water, drained), or salmon are great choices because you know exactly what protein source you are giving.
  • Omega-3 Fatty Acids (Fish Oil): These healthy fats can help reduce inflammation often associated with kidney disease.
  • Limited, Simple Ingredients: Fewer ingredients mean fewer potential stressors for the cat’s system.
Ingredients to Avoid:
  • Meat By-Products or Meals: These are often lower quality and higher in phosphorus than whole cuts of meat.
  • High Levels of Grains or Fillers: Things like corn, wheat, or soy add unnecessary bulk and can sometimes be harder to digest.
  • Artificial Colors, Flavors, or Preservatives (BHA/BHT): Keep the ingredient list clean.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) About Kidney Cat Treats

Q: How often can I give my cat a kidney-safe treat?

A: Even safe treats should be given sparingly. Treats should make up no more than 10% of your cat’s total daily calories. Always discuss the frequency with your veterinarian.

Q: Are freeze-dried single-ingredient meats safe?

A: Usually, yes. Freeze-dried chicken or tuna (without added salt or phosphorus additives) are often excellent choices because they are high in quality protein and low in fillers.

Q: What is the biggest danger in a regular cat treat for a kidney cat?

A: The biggest danger is high phosphorus content. This forces the already failing kidneys to work much harder than they should.

Q: Do I need a prescription for the best kidney treats?

A: No. While prescription renal diets are available, many excellent over-the-counter treats exist. However, always check the label against your vet’s guidelines.

Q: How do I check the phosphorus content if it is not listed?

A: If the label doesn’t list phosphorus, contact the manufacturer directly. If they cannot provide the information quickly, it is safer to choose a different brand.

Q: Can I just give my cat a tiny piece of their prescription food as a treat?

A: Yes, this is often the safest route! Measuring out a small portion of their prescribed renal kibble or wet food works perfectly as a low-risk reward.

Q: Should I worry about sodium levels as much as phosphorus?

A: Yes, sodium is important, especially if your cat also has high blood pressure (hypertension). Low sodium supports overall cardiovascular and kidney health.

Q: My cat loves fish treats. Are all fish treats okay?

A: Not all. While some fish like salmon are good sources of Omega-3s, canned fish often has high sodium. Always choose fish treats specifically low in salt and phosphorus.

Q: What texture works best for older cats with kidney disease?

A: Older cats might have dental issues. Soft, moist, or easily dissolvable treats are usually best for easy chewing and swallowing.

Q: If a treat is grain-free, is it automatically kidney-friendly?

A: No. Grain-free only means it lacks wheat or corn. It can still be very high in phosphorus if it contains high amounts of legumes or certain animal meals.
